Understanding what typically causes water damage in Dimondale can help you catch a problem early — before it turns into a full emergency call.
Supply lines behind washing machines, dishwashers, and refrigerators wear out over time. When they fail, water can spread through a Dimondale property for hours before anyone notices, soaking into flooring and cabinetry.
Heavy storms, wind-driven rain, and aging roofing materials all contribute to water intrusion in Dimondale homes and businesses, especially in older roof systems nearing the end of their lifespan.
A failed sump pump during a heavy rain event is one of the fastest ways a Dimondale basement goes from dry to flooded — often within a single storm, with little warning.
A slowly failing water heater in a Dimondale home can leak for weeks before it's discovered, often causing more structural damage than a sudden pipe burst would.
Poor drainage patterns are a frequent contributor to recurring water issues in Dimondale basements, especially in older neighborhoods with mature landscaping and settled soil.
Water used to extinguish a fire, or an accidental sprinkler discharge, can leave a Dimondale property with significant secondary water damage that needs immediate attention right after the fire crew leaves.

Plenty of Dimondale homeowners try to handle a small water event themselves before calling us. Here's what usually gets missed.
What makes DIY cleanup risky isn't the initial mop-up — it's everything you can't see afterward. Standard household fans move air across a surface, but they don't pull moisture out of building materials the way commercial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ers do. That gap is exactly where Dimondale homeowners end up with mold problems weeks or months down the line.
Insurance carriers generally want to see documented proof that a water loss was properly mitigated. A DIY cleanup rarely produces that kind of record, which can leave Dimondale homeowners exposed if related damage — like mold or warped subfloor — shows up months later and the carrier questions whether it was handled correctly the first time.
None of this means every spill needs a professional crew — a small, contained, surface-level spill that's dried within a few hours is usually fine to handle yourself. But once water has soaked into flooring, baseboards, or drywall, or if it's been sitting for more than a few hours, it's worth a call to make sure nothing's hiding beneath the surface.
The minutes before our Dimondale crew arrives matter. Here's what our dispatchers typically recommend, situation permitting.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
Never touch electrical switches, outlets, or appliances that are wet or near standing water — the risk of shock is real.
Lifting rugs, moving boxes, and relocating valuables can reduce secondary damage while you wait for our team.
A quick photo record of standing water and affected belongings makes the insurance process smoother down the line.
Some airflow can help, but don't rely on it alone — professional drying equipment is still necessary to prevent mold.
Delaying the call is the most common mistake we see. Standing water only gets more expensive to fix the longer it sits.
